Abstract
The authors present a 12 channel InGaAsP/InP wavelength selective router which operates at 2.5 Gbit/s channel rates and uses a slab waveguide based transmission grating. Insertion losses of 7.7 dB and crosstalk levels of –25 dB are measured.Keywords
